97 Vinous -
The 2013 Geremia shows just how exceptional this vintage is in Chianti Classico. Vibrant, powerful and structured, the 2013 is a thoroughbred that is going to need a number of years to be at its best. Black cherry, plum, exotic spice, graphite, sage and lavender infuse the intense, massively powerful finish. This fruit was picked on October 3 and 4, which is on the later side for the estate. What a wine!

About the Producer

Rocca di Montegrossi is located near Monti in Chianti, one of the finest sections of Chianti Classico, about 7 km south of Gaiole. Rocca di Montegrossi's owner, Marco Ricasoli-Firidolfi, is descended from a family that played a central role in the history of the Chianti Classico region and laid the foundations for Chianti Classico wine. The estate extends over an area of 100 hectares; 20 are planted to vine, another 20 are olive groves. The vineyards, on gentle south and southeast-facing hillsides with calcareous loamy soils, are at elevations between 340 and 510 meters above sea level.
